Ben Williams is an Associate Professor in the Department of Engineering Science, where he leads a research group focusing on developing and applying linear and non-linear optical diagnostic techniques to solve challenges in thermofluids, heat transfer, mixing, and combustion. Utilizing advanced optical tools, his work is centered on conducting highly precise measurements of temperature, pressure, flow fields, and species concentrations with exceptional spatial and temporal resolution. His collaborative efforts include a close association with the engines group designed to foster integration with colleagues working on turbomachinery. His expertise encompasses a wide range of topics such as photophysics and laser interactions with molecules, characterizing nanoparticle formation, and measuring in-cylinder temperatures in internal combustion engines.
